The Massey Ferguson 2725, manufactured from 1982 to 1986, was a popular and reliable workhorse on farms across North America. Powered by a Perkins A6.354 naturally aspirated diesel engine producing around 85 horsepower, it offered ample power for a variety of tasks. With a PTO horsepower of approximately 75, this tractor was well-suited for pulling implements and powering various farm implements, gaining a reputation for its durability and straightforward design.
The Massey Ferguson 2725 was introduced in 1982 and produced until 1986, filling a crucial power range in the Massey Ferguson lineup. It was equipped with a Perkins A6.354 5.8L (354 cu.in.) naturally aspirated diesel engine, delivering approximately 85 engine horsepower. The engine was known for its robust construction and reliable performance. The 2725 came standard with a mechanical transmission offering 8 forward and 2 reverse speeds, providing adequate gear selection for various field conditions. Its PTO delivered around 75 horsepower, available in both 540 RPM and 1000 RPM options, catering to a wide range of implements. The hydraulic system had a capacity of approximately 11.5 GPM, and typically featured two remote valves. The 3-point hitch was Category II, offering a lift capacity of around 4,500 lbs, allowing it to handle a variety of implements. The 2725 was commonly used in row crop operations, hay production, livestock management (primarily for feeding and material handling), and light tillage work. Unlike some of the larger, more sophisticated Massey Ferguson models, the 2725 prioritized simplicity and dependability, making it a favorite among farmers seeking a practical and cost-effective tractor.

Maintenance Tips
- Engine Oil & Filter: Change your engine oil and filter every 250 hours using a high-quality diesel-rated oil and the correct oil filter. Regular oil changes are crucial for engine longevity.
- Hydraulic System: Inspect your hydraulic fluid regularly for contamination (water or debris). Change the hydraulic fluid and filter per the manufacturer's recommendation (typically every 500-1000 hours) to prevent damage to hydraulic components.
- Fuel System: Use clean, fresh fuel and consider adding a fuel stabilizer, especially during seasonal storage, to prevent fuel degradation and injector issues. Check and replace fuel filters regularly.
- Seasonal Storage: Before storing your tractor for the winter, completely fill the fuel tank to prevent condensation, grease all lubrication points, and disconnect the battery. Store the battery in a cool, dry place.

Frequently Asked Questions
What engine is in the Massey Ferguson 2725?
The Massey Ferguson 2725 is equipped with a Perkins A6.354 naturally aspirated diesel engine producing approximately 85 horsepower with a displacement of 5.8L (354 cubic inches).
What is the PTO horsepower on a 2725?
The PTO horsepower on a Massey Ferguson 2725 is approximately 75 horsepower. It typically offers both 540 RPM and 1000 RPM PTO speed options, allowing compatibility with a variety of implements.
What oil filter fits the 2725?
The correct oil filter for the Massey Ferguson 2725 is commonly a Baldwin B229 or a Fram PH3600. Always verify compatibility with your specific engine configuration.
What are common parts needed for the 2725?
Common wear parts for the Massey Ferguson 2725 include engine oil filters, fuel filters, air filters, hydraulic filters, belts (fan belt, alternator belt), hydraulic cylinder seal kits, steering components (tie rod ends), and clutch components (clutch disc, pressure plate, throwout bearing).
